State courts to send mental illness cases to FBI background checks office | The Morning Sentinel, Waterville, ME
:yes2:'Federal law prohibits possession of a firearm or ammunition by any person who has been "adjudicated as a mental defective" or involuntarily "committed to any mental institution."' :yes2:
:blink::blink::blink:'No federal law, however, requires states to report the identities of these individuals to the National Instant Criminal Background Check System database, which the FBI uses to perform background checks prior to firearm sales.' :blink::blink::blink:
An otherwise good federal law is extremely watered down if it doesn't require reporting from the States. WTF....glad Maine is taking that step.
